Pacifica Foundation’s exec. director fired by new chair

Daily Planet staff
Thursday October 25, 2001

Pacifica Foundation Executive Director Bessie Wash has been fired by the new board chair Robert Farrell, according to a press statement from KPFA advocates and verified by programmer Larry Bensky. 

Farrell has also agreed to court-supervised mediation of the pending law suits. 

Wash, formerly station manager of Pacifica station WPFW in Washington, was named executive director by a board then controlled by former chair Mary Frances Berry.  

She has presided over “the banning of Pacifica's only remaining nationwide program, ‘Democracy Now,’ (and) the ‘mainstreaming’ of the once alternative daily Pacifica Network News,” the press statement says. 

Farrell was not available for comment.
